I put a golf ball in each chicken nest in the chicken house a few days ago and this evening I find two of them in the yard behind our kitchen porch. Apparently our pup (Miss Midnight the Black Lab) raided the nests and got a mouthful of golf ball. She chewed one in half!
She never bothers the chickens but I bet she has taken eggs before because some days I get no eggs, although I have never seen egg shells in the nests or any where around the chicken house.
We free range our chickens but the last week they have been locked up because they were making a nest out in the tractor shed. This afternoon was the first afternoon I had let them out because I had gathered all their eggs and only the golf balls were left in the nests.
Now to figure out how to break the dog from going to the nests.
